Output 59e9194bd3778d1e98a766d0e5480b4bd0581be285dc6fe220d3def6bfe3da29:1

value
7281071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fe1b83c2ea5ce5f9a365f5834356868664a72d9 OP_EQUAL
address
3EonxFdMoi2ptV8xH7tapnJx6WvrvcoAC5
transaction
59e9194bd3778d1e98a766d0e5480b4bd0581be285dc6fe220d3def6bfe3da29
spent
true